History of an oil painting and ANNOOT
In the sale in England of Geh. the Honorable Edward P. Lygon , deceased , on May 11 , 1875
the lot 153 was "Mignard , Mademoiselle de Fontanges with Cupid" and it was sold to "ANNOOT" for £ 18.7.6. ( handwritten minutes of the auction sale ) . The painting is now in France .
Has an ANNOOT belonging to your family been resident in England at that time ? Could he have been interested in paintings ( personnally or professionnally - eg arts broker, expert , dealer - ) and in the affirmative , do you know of any sale of his belongings which may help to trace the history of the painting between England at the beg of the XIXth century ( where it is well documentated ) and France ( where it is first documentated at an auction sale of Mrs Joseph THORS deceased on June 13 1929) .
